Ceramicist: Exploring the Art and Craft of Pottery Making

A ceramicist is an artist who specializes in creating pottery through various techniques such as wheel throwing, hand-building, and glazing. This craft involves not only technical skill but also artistic creativity, as ceramicists often experiment with different forms, textures, and finishes to create unique pieces of art. The process of pottery making is a labor-intensive and intricate one, requiring patience, precision, and a deep understanding of the properties of clay and glazes.

Potter: Understanding the Traditional Role of a Pottery Maker

A potter is a skilled artisan who practices the traditional craft of pottery making, using techniques that have been passed down through generations. Potters typically work with clay to create functional objects such as bowls, plates, and vases, as well as decorative pieces like sculptures and figurines. The role of a potter is steeped in history and tradition, with many potters drawing inspiration from ancient pottery styles and techniques. Through their work, potters help to preserve and celebrate the rich cultural heritage of pottery making.

Clay Artist: Blurring the Lines Between Pottery and Fine Art

As a clay artist, the focus is on pushing the boundaries of traditional pottery making by incorporating elements of fine art into the craft. By experimenting with different techniques and forms, clay artists strive to create pieces that not only serve a functional purpose but also evoke emotions and tell a story. This fusion of pottery and fine art allows for a deeper exploration of creativity and expression, challenging the conventional definitions of both disciplines.

Ceramic Sculptor: Elevating Pottery Making to a Form of Sculptural Art

As a ceramic sculptor, the focus shifts from functional pottery to creating pieces that challenge traditional perceptions of clay art. By incorporating sculptural elements into pottery making, artists can explore new forms, textures, and concepts that elevate their work to the realm of fine art. This fusion of pottery and sculpture allows for a deeper exploration of artistic expression and pushes the boundaries of what is possible with clay as a medium.
